Work as a significant part of the software team in developing cutting-edge solutions. Design and develop software on any platform, as per the design document and given specifications. Comprehensive research and development is required for developing the application and its features. Troubleshoot and test the game including debugging identifying bottlenecks to devise a solution. Contribute unique and personal ideas toward all aspects of the application production and development. Customer Interface (External and Internal) Interact with clients as and when required. Understand client requirements and translate same into software design Work closely with a cross-functional team of developers, designers, and researchers to come up with a one-of-a-kind solution. Mentor and Coach the team to enhance their skills and competencies. Work with your manager and senior management team to ensure the implementation of the Open to explore new technologies Good understanding of DevOps, GIT Good communication skills Exposure to Kafka - Must Knowledge of CI/CD pipeline Design and implement new features and enhancements to our complex analytics products. Analyze requirements, and propose solutions using software modules. Use programming languages, data management tools, and orchestration tools to implement designs. Integrate solutions with internal services. Lead group brainstorming and problem-solving sessions, conduct training sessions on high value technical topics, and provide technical support to colleagues. Use workflow tools to keep track of tasks, manage quality, and help with developer productivity. Develop proficiency with Nielsen s internal platforms, help teammates navigate technical blockers, and perform code reviews. Provide technical feedback and mentorship, facilitate discussions around solution implementation, and merge changes after successful peer reviews.